50 masterpieces will be presented at the first exhibition in the Primorsky branch of the Tretyakov Gallery
15 September 2017, Friday

The first exhibition of paintings from the collection of the State Tretyakov Gallery will open in Primorye in late November. According to the head of the region Vladimir Miklushevsky, the exposition will feature about 50 masterpieces.


The exposition is planned to be changed every few months. The exhibition will be held in the Seaside State Picture Gallery, which will become a branch of the Tretyakov Gallery.


The agreement on the creation of a seaside branch of the Tretyakov Gallery was signed by the Governor of Primorye, Vladimir Miklushevsky, and the director of the State Tretyakov Gallery, Zelphir Tregulov, on August 31.
